The global heavy cargo transport industry is the backbone of international industrial growth. From massive wind turbine blades to heavy mining machinery and prefabricated construction modules, the movement of "Project Cargo" requires more than just standard shipping; it demands engineering precision, specialized equipment, and a deep understanding of international maritime and terrestrial regulations. As of 2024, the market is witnessing a surge driven by global infrastructure projects and the transition to renewable energy.

International buyers from Europe, North America, and the Middle East are increasingly looking for "One-Stop Shop" exporters. The demand has shifted from simple port-to-port shipping to comprehensive DDP (Delivered Duty Paid) services. Clients now require factories and agents who can handle complex customs clearance, tax payments, and specialized unloading equipment at the destination—be it a construction site in Peru or a warehouse in the UK.
